LeBron James vs. Stephen A. Smith: Feud Escalates with Punch Threats and 'Taylor Swift Tour' Jabs

A courtside confrontation between NBA superstar LeBron James and ESPN analyst Stephen A. Smith has spilled into a public war of words, marked by sharp accusations and even a hypothetical punch threat. The feud highlights ongoing tensions surrounding media commentary and player privacy.

Key Insights

Stephen A. Smith's Threat:: Smith stated on his show that had LeBron James touched him during their March 6th courtside exchange at Madison Square Garden, he would have "immediately swung on him," while admitting he likely would have lost the physical altercation.

LeBron's Rebuttal:: James, speaking on "The Pat McAfee Show," accused Smith of seeking attention ("He’s like on a Taylor Swift tour run right now") and misinterpreting the reason for the confrontation, stating Smith got too "personal" with criticism aimed at his son, Bronny James.

Origin of the Dispute:: The initial conflict arose from Smith's comments suggesting Bronny James's presence in the NBA is solely due to his father's influence.

Smith Doubles Down:: Smith responded to LeBron's interview by calling him a "liar," "two-faced," and reiterated his dislike for the player. He also criticized James's remarks about Giannis Antetokounmpo dominating previous eras as "disrespectful."

Why this matters:: This public spat underscores the sensitive line between sports analysis and personal criticism, particularly involving players' families, and raises questions about the relationship between athletes and influential media figures.

In-Depth Analysis

The feud ignited publicly following a courtside incident during the Los Angeles Lakers vs. New York Knicks game on March 6, 2025. Cameras caught James approaching Smith, who was seated courtside. Smith later revealed James confronted him about comments made concerning his son, USC guard and Lakers draftee Bronny James. Smith had previously stated on ESPN's "First Take" that Bronny was in the league primarily because of LeBron.

Following the incident, Smith discussed the confrontation extensively across various platforms. LeBron James broke his silence on March 26th during an interview with Pat McAfee. He dismissed Smith's defense, arguing that while criticism of on-court performance is fair game, Smith crossed a line by making it personal regarding his son. James mocked Smith's repeated discussions of the event, comparing it to a "Taylor Swift tour."

Smith swiftly retaliated on his own show, making the inflammatory claim about punching James if touched and launching further personal attacks, calling James a "liar" and asserting mutual dislike. He stated, "Don't the truth matter? Because there's one person in this ordeal that's telling the truth and it's me... his a** lies a lot and there's a lot of shady stuff he does." Smith also took issue with James's hypothetical scenario on McAfee's show where Giannis Antetokounmpo would score '250 points' in the 1970s, deeming it disrespectful to past NBA legends.

Interestingly, since the controversy began, Bronny James has seen an uptick in performance, including a career-high 17 points for the Lakers and a 39-point game for their G League affiliate.
